Every once and a while, Ferrari really one-ups itself when it comes to producing a road-going vehicle.

There was the 288 GTO, F40, F50 and Enzo. But it's been a while since we've had something "Enzo-like." Too long, in fact.

Now with the 2013 Geneva Motor Show bearing down on us, it's official: we will be seeing the next-generation Ferrari flagship take a bow in Geneva.

New special series car to debut at Geneva


Ferrari's new limited edition special series car receives its world unveiling at the Geneva International Motor Show on Tuesday, March 5th next. This leaves just a few days to go before all the details of a model generating a huge sense of anticipation, are revealed. From today, however, enthusiasts can find intriguing hints at what lies in store from Ferrari at Geneva, by keeping a daily eye on the Maranello marque's website and official Facebook pages.
